What is a transformation?

A point is transformed when it is moved from where it was originally to a new location. Translation, rotation, reflection, and dilation are examples of different transformations.

To graph a polygon with vertices A(0,5), B(10,-5), and C(5,-5), we can plot these points on a coordinate plane and connect them to form a triangle.

Then, to find the image of this triangle after a dilation with scale factor k = 120%, we need to multiply each coordinate of the vertices by k = 1.2.

For vertex A, the new coordinates would be (0 × 1.2, 5 × 1.2) = (0, 6).

For vertex B, the new coordinates would be (10 × 1.2, -5 × 1.2) = (12, -6).

For vertex C, the new coordinates would be (5 × 1.2, -5 × 1.2) = (6, -6).

So, the new triangle with vertices A'(0, 6), B'(12, -6), and C'(6, -6) would be larger than the original triangle by a factor of 120%.

For students majoring in Hospitality Management, it was determined that 5% have visited 1–10 states, 16% have visited 11–20 states, 45% have visited 21–30 states, 19% have visited 31–40 states, and 15% have visited 41–50 states. Suppose a Hospitality Management student is randomly selected. What is the probability that the student has visited 21 or more states?

A . 0.15
B. 0.21
C. 0.45
D. 0.79

Answers

Answer:

D. 0.79

Step-by-step explanation:

To find the probability that a Hospitality Management student has visited 21 or more states, we need to sum up the probabilities of the categories that represent students who have visited 21 states or more.

The probabilities of the categories are as follows:

Visited 21–30 states: 45% = 0.45

Visited 31–40 states: 19% = 0.19

Visited 41–50 states: 15% = 0.15

So, the total probability of a student having visited 21 or more states is:

0.45 + 0.19 + 0.15 = 0.79.

Therefore, the probability that a Hospitality Management student has visited 21 or more states is 0.79 or 79%.

If F(x) = f(g(x)), where f(-2) = 5, f'(-2) = 9, f'(4) = 3, g(4) = -2, and g'(4) = 4, find F'(4).
F'(4) =

Answers

Answer:

36.

Step-by-step explanation:

o find F'(4), we need to use the chain rule of differentiation. The chain rule states that if F(x) = f(g(x)), then F'(x) = f'(g(x)) * g'(x).

Given that f(-2) = 5, f'(-2) = 9, f'(4) = 3, g(4) = -2, and g'(4) = 4, we can calculate F'(4) as follows:

F'(4) = f'(g(4)) * g'(4) = f'(-2) * g'(4) = 9 * 4 = 36

Therefore, F'(4) = 36.

Solving For #7

We will use the Angle Bisector Theorem

The angle bisector theorem states that in a triangle, the angle bisector of any angle will divide the opposite side in the ratio of the sides containing the angle.

In the figure provided in #7 we see that QS bisects ∠Q forming two smaller triangles ΔPQS and ΔQRS

According to the angle bisector theorem:

[tex]\dfrac{PQ}{QR} = \dfrac{PS}{RS}\\\\\textrm{Or, alternatively}\\\\\dfrac{QR}{PQ} = \dfrac{RS}{PS}\\[/tex]

Given
[tex]QR = 12.6\\PQ = 7\\RS = x\\PS = 5\\\\[/tex]

[tex]\dfrac{PQ}{QR} = \dfrac{PS}{RS}\\\\\textrm{Or, alternatively}\\\\\dfrac{QR}{PQ} = \dfrac{RS}{PS}\\\\\\\rightarrow \dfrac{12.6}{7} = \dfrac{x}{5}[/tex]

If we multiply by [tex]5[/tex] both sides of the equation we can get rid of the denominator 5 on the right side:
[tex]\rightarrow \dfrac{12.6}{7} \times 5 = x\\\\9 = x\\\\\boxed{x = 9}[/tex]
